Responsibilities:
  • Provide company and customers with application expertise including both electrical and mechanical design engineering.
  • Size, select and sell electro-mechanical drive systems in a cost conscious manner and low risk of failure. This requires knowledge of important application characteristics such as those found, for example, in winding, indexing and hoisting applications.
  • Develop strategies and product comparisons for promoting company Electronic and Mechanical products in those industries.
  • Assist inside sales with: requests for quotes and orders for nonstandard product assemblies/modifications to ensure product is technically acceptable and has a low risk of failure, with ratings and technical data on nonstandard products, and training on new products and/or product changes.
  • Must maintain working knowledge of all company products.
  • Monitor, identify, and improve quality of company product and support by working with all personnel.
  • Ensure timely responses are provided for all inquiries.
  • Support all company personnel in their efforts to satisfy company and customer needs.
  • Provide electrical expertise, assistance and training for the assembly shop.
  • Identify and implement continual improvements to increase safety, quality and productivity.
  • Ensure technical compliance by reviewing drive specifications and job requirements as supplied by customers.
  • Develop an understanding of the major markets in his or her area of responsibility.
  • Maintain technical documentation in a current and orderly manner.
  • Assist with regional training needs and provide ongoing complete product training for company personnel.
  • Support company technical staff and customers in the startup, commissioning, and programming of company electronic drives.
  • Develop training and documentation materials for customer training courses as required.
  • Attend training seminars on company products.
  • Perform service-related tasks at customer sites.
  • Self-train on company electro-mechanical products on a continuous basis.
  • Report issues regarding pricing or features of electronic products to the TASC specialist for incorporation into future products. Relay customer complaints and observations about the electro-mechanical products and documentation in the same way.
